Yen Press announced new licensing acquisitions including light novels 'See You at That Site of Grace After Work' and 'Your Castle's Little Helper,' alongside manga titles. This expands their catalog of Japanese-origin content for English readers.

The anime adaptation of Amara's light novel 'Neko to Ryuu' has announced additional cast members and a second promotional video. The series is set to premiere in July 2026 on Tokyo MX, BS NTV, and Yomiuri TV, directed by Jin-Gu Oh at OLM.
A short-form live-action series adaptation of the popular BL webtoon 'Painter of the Night' by Byeonduck is set for release on May 28 exclusively on Lezhin Snack. The series will be available on the Lezhin platform's dedicated short-form content service.
